Product Overview

The RCA RCRN04GBE is a versatile 4-device universal remote control designed to simplify your home entertainment experience. It allows you to control up to four different audio/video components, such as TVs, satellite/cable boxes, DVD/VCR players, and streaming devices, from a single remote. Its ergonomic and thin design ensures comfortable handling, while the green backlit keypad enhances visibility in low-light conditions.

Setup Instructions

1. Battery Installation

  1. Open the battery compartment cover on the back of the remote control.
  2. Insert two new AAA batteries, ensuring correct polarity (+ and -).
  3. Close the battery compartment cover securely.

2. Programming Your Remote Control

The RCA RCRN04GBE can be programmed using either direct code entry or auto code search. Refer to the included code list for your specific device brands.

Direct Code Entry:

  1. Turn on the device you wish to control (e.g., TV, DVD player).
  2. Press and hold the SETUP button until the red indicator light stays on.
  3. Press the device button you want to program (e.g., TV, DVD). The indicator light will blink once and remain on.
  4. Enter the 4-digit code for your device brand from the code list. The indicator light will turn off if the code is valid.
  5. Test the remote by pressing the POWER button. If the device turns off, the remote is programmed. If not, repeat the steps with the next code for your brand.

Auto Code Search:

  1. Turn on the device you wish to control.
  2. Press and hold the SETUP button until the red indicator light stays on.
  3. Press the device button you want to program. The indicator light will blink once and remain on.
  4. Point the remote at the device and press the POWER button repeatedly (approximately every 2 seconds) until the device turns off.
  5. Once the device turns off, press the ENTER button to save the code.
  6. Test the remote's functions. If some functions do not work, repeat the auto code search to find a more compatible code.

Operating Instructions

After successfully programming your RCA RCRN04GBE universal remote, you can begin controlling your devices. Ensure the remote is pointed directly at the device you wish to control.

1. Selecting a Device

To control a specific device, press the corresponding device button at the top of the remote (TV, STR for streaming, AUD for audio, etc.). The indicator light will briefly illuminate to confirm your selection.

3. Advanced Functions (Colored Keys)

The red, blue, yellow, and green keys provide access to advanced functions specific to certain devices, such as cable box features, satellite functions, or Blu-ray player controls. Their specific functions may vary depending on the device and its programming.

Specifications

Product Dimensions4.5 x 1.8 x 11 inches
Item Weight5.8 ounces
ManufacturerRCA
Model NumberRCRN04GBE
Batteries Required2 AAA batteries (sold separately)
Special FeatureBacklit, Ergonomic, Universal
ColorGloss Black
Max Number of Supported Devices4
Compatible DevicesTV, SAT/CBL/DTC, DVD/VCR, Streaming Players
